Finance Review Summary — Q3 Regional Sales, Eastvale Division

Prepared for the finance team. Eastvale closed the quarter 6% above plan, driven largely by renewals on the Lumara suite, while the Tarnwick branch missed target due to delayed enterprise signings. Expense ratios held steady; travel spend rose modestly against the prior quarter. Variance detail is in the appendix workbook. Provisioning for Q4 should follow the guidance below, which reflects our near-term plans.

management briefing: Project Ulavan slips by two quarters because of the staffing delay.

## Tuning export retries

Failed exports in Lanternmill are retried with exponential backoff. The worker pool picks up failed jobs from the retry queue and honors the per-tenant concurrency cap, so bumping retry counts without raising the cap just lengthens the queue. If exports to the Quarrow archive keep timing out, prefer increasing the timeout over the attempt count. The defaults below have held up well in production; adjust them together, not individually.

limits module of fajog-tawig:
RATE_LIMITS = {
    "druwyn": 2,
    "quenael": 10,
    "wenix": 2,
    "druael": 2,
}

It runs in three environments: dev, staging, and production. Dev uses a local mock mailbox; staging consumes a sandboxed feed with scrubbed addresses; production reads from the live bounce mailbox. All environments classify bounces as hard or soft and update suppression lists accordingly. Production access is restricted to the messaging-platform role, and all writes are audited. For the security review, the production deployment currently runs with the following configuration.

config for kafof-bawef:
holath:
  log_level: debug
  metrics_host: metrics.holath.qorvelsys.internal
  pin: 2191
  pool_size: 32

## Onboarding: Order-Cutoff Rule

At Millwheel Bakery, the Ovenline service locks new orders at 14:00 local so the prep queue can be finalized for next-day baking. The cutoff job runs on the Brindle scheduler; never edit it directly. If the scheduler misses the lock and orders keep flowing, trigger the manual lock from the admin vault, which opens with the passphrase below.

vault phrase of taguf-taguf = ralath-briwyn